Prime Minister Keir Starmer said Monday that the UK will ban children under 16 from major social media platforms, including TikTok, Instagram, Threads, Facebook, X, YouTube, Snapchat and Reddit, under online safety reforms announced at a Downing Street press conference. The government says the ban will follow Australia’s under-16 model but go further by restricting romantic or sexual AI chatbots and blocking children from chatting with strangers on gaming platforms.
